Introduction to Ticketing system

Free ticket selling platforms have revolutionised the way we sell tickets online, providing a digital solution that's incredibly easy to use. They are designed to streamline event management, making it possible for both large-scale event producers and small-scale hobbyists to create, promote, and manage online event with unparalleled ease.

These platforms have moved away from the traditional model of physical tickets, transitioning into a digital environment that offers the ability to manage event payment online. This shift towards digitisation has resulted in a service that is not just more convenient, but also significantly more efficient. Gone are the days of long queues and misplaced event tickets; now, attending an event is as simple as showing a QR code on a smartphone.

One of the most appealing aspects of these platforms is their ability to handle recurring events. This feature is incredibly beneficial for event organisers who run weekly or monthly events, as it eliminates the need for continuous manual input. Instead, they can set up the event once and schedule it to repeat as required, freeing up their time to focus on other important aspects of event planning.

For event producers, these platforms provide a range of tools to customise their event pages. They are given complete branding control, allowing them to design the look and feel of their event to align with their brand image. This ability to personalise the platform helps to create a more immersive and consistent experience for attendees.

In terms of ticketing, these platforms offer the flexibility to create multiple ticket types. This can range from standard entry tickets to VIP packages, making it possible to cater to a diverse audience. Moreover, they also provide the option to generate promo codes, a feature that can be used to reward loyal customers or incentivise potential attendees.

Ticket Tailor

Ticket Tailor stands out amongst many ticketing software platforms due to its unique pricing structure. Unlike most other platforms that typically levy a fee per ticket sold, Ticket Tailor adopts a different approach, completely eliminating this cost. This unique approach makes it a particularly excellent option for larger events where online sales volume is expected to be high.

Ticket Tailor only charges for payment fees, thus providing organizers the opportunity to save substantially on ticketing expenses. This approach is a testament to its commitment to providing cost-effective solutions to organizers, regardless of the scale of their events.

Moreover, Ticket Tailor equips organizers with all the tools they need for crowd control and event management. From creating and customising tickets to managing attendee lists and processing payments, it offers a comprehensive suite of features that contribute to the smooth execution of the perfect event

Real-Time Updates

One of the key features of free ticket selling platforms is the provision of real-time updates on ticket sales. This aspect of the system is incredibly beneficial for event professionals, offering them an instant snapshot of their event's progress.

As these platforms enable you to sell tickets online, they typically come equipped with a dynamic dashboard that gives an up-to-the-minute account of how many tickets have been sold and how many remain. This real-time data can be vital in decision-making processes, allowing organizers to understand the demand for their event and make necessary adjustments promptly.

For both paid and free events, being able to monitor these metrics in real time can greatly improve the event registration experience. If tickets are selling out fast, for example, it might be possible to arrange for additional capacity or set up a waiting list. Conversely, if sales are slow, it could signal the need for further marketing efforts or adjustments to the event page to make it more appealing.

Overcoming Challenges with Free Ticket Selling Platforms

While the advantages of using free ticket selling platforms are plentiful, it's important to acknowledge that potential challenges may also arise. However, with a little foresight and planning, these can be easily overcome.

Service Fees

One such challenge relates to service fees. While the ticketing platform itself may allow you to sell tickets online for free, service fees can be added when tickets for paid events are sold. This could potentially impact the pricing of your tickets and the overall revenue from the event. One way to overcome this is by factoring the service fees into your ticket pricing from the outset, ensuring that these additional costs do not eat into your profit margin. Alternatively, you can opt for a platform that charges a flat fee or lower fees, ensuring that your ticket buyers are not deterred by additional costs when purchasing.

Customisation Limitations

Another challenge can be the limitations on customisation. Some platforms may restrict the amount of customisation you can apply to your event's ticketing or event page. This can potentially impact the consistency of your branding and the overall appeal of your event. To overcome this, you could seek out platforms that offer greater flexibility in terms of customisation. Some platforms, while not completely free, might offer premium plans that provide extensive customisation options. This could be a worthwhile investment to ensure a successful event. Alternatively, you could utilise features such as discount codes to provide a personalised experience for attendees, even within the customisation limitations.

How do free ticket selling platforms make money?

While free ticket selling platforms allow you to start selling tickets at no cost, they typically generate revenue through various other means. Many of these platforms offer premium features or services for which they charge. For instance, while the basic online ticketing system might be free, advanced features or additional services might come at a cost. Additionally, some platforms may charge a fee for ticketed events, usually a small percentage of the ticket price paid by ticket buyers. Advertising is another common revenue source for these platforms.
